返回

晶振负载电容计算方法介绍

2026-03-04
1210 阅读

一、什么是晶振负载电容

晶体振荡器(Crystal Oscillator)在振荡电路中需要配置合适的负载电容(CL),否则会导致起振困难、频率偏移、甚至不工作。
晶振的规格书(Datasheet)通常会标注推荐的 负载电容 CL,常见值有 12pF、16pF、18pF、20pF 等。


二、负载电容的计算公式

晶振实际看到的负载电容由两侧接地电容(C1、C2)和电路寄生电容(Cstray)共同决定,公式为:

CL=C1×C2C1+C2+CstrayCL = \frac{C1 \times C2}{C1 + C2} + C_{stray}

其中:

  • C1、C2:晶振两脚分别接地的电容值(一般对称,如相同的电容)。

  • Cstray:寄生电容,包括 PCB 走线、电容焊盘、IC 输入管脚电容等,一般取 2pF~5pF


三、计算实例

假设某晶振要求的 CL = 16pF,PCB 寄生电容估算为 Cstray = 3pF
设定 C1 = C2 = Cx,代入公式:

16=Cx×CxCx+Cx+316 = \frac{Cx \times Cx}{Cx + Cx} + 316=Cx2+316 = \frac{Cx}{2} + 3Cx=(163)×2=26pFCx = (16 - 3) \times 2 = 26pF

即:C1 = C2 ≈ 26pF。

所以,PCB 上需要放置 两个 27pF(标准值)电容


四、常见设计经验

  1. 对称选择:通常 C1 和 C2 取相同值,保证晶振两脚负载平衡。

  2. 考虑寄生电容:实际设计中,如果忽略 Cstray,可能导致振荡频率偏差。

  3. 调频用途:通过适当调整 C1、C2 的值,可以对晶振的工作频率进行微调。

  4. 常见电容取值:多在 12pF ~ 33pF 之间,具体取决于晶振 CL 要求。

  5. 单片机参考设计:如 STM32 官方推荐电容计算时,往往假设 Cstray=5pF,并选取标准 E24 系列电容。


五、快速计算步骤总结

  1. 从晶振 Datasheet 查出 CL 要求。

  2. 估算 PCB 与芯片引脚的寄生电容 Cstray(一般 2~5pF)。

  3. 使用公式:

    C1=C2=2×(CLCstray)C1 = C2 = 2 \times (CL - Cstray)

  4. 选择最接近的标准电容值。


isnd电容是什么品牌 揭秘电容使用误区,掌握正确选择技巧